      With a stay at Hilton Garden Inn Greensboro in Greensboro, you'll be in the business district, within a 10-minute drive of Greensboro Coliseum and Celebration Station. This hotel is 6.8 mi (11 km) from North Carolina A and T State University and 7.5 mi (12.1 km) from Wet 'n Wild Emerald Pointe Water Park.Enjoy recreational amenities such as an indoor pool and a 24-hour fitness center. Additional features at this hotel include complimentary wireless internet access, a fireplace in the lobby, and a banquet hall.You can enjoy a meal at Garden Grille & Bar serving the guests of Hilton Garden Inn Greensboro, or stop in at the grocery/convenience store. Wrap up your day with a drink at the bar/lounge. Buffet breakfasts are served on weekdays from 6:00 AM to 10:00 AM and on weekends from 7:00 AM to 11:00 AM for a fee.Featured amenities include complimentary wired internet access, a 24-hour business center, and express check-in. Planning an event in Greensboro? This hotel has 1744 square feet (162 square meters) of space consisting of conference space and meeting rooms. Free self parking is available onsite.Make yourself at home in one of the 134 guestrooms featuring refrigerators and LCD televisions. Your bed comes with down comforters and premium bedding. Complimentary wired and wireless intern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ming provides entertainment. Private bathrooms have complimentary toiletries and hair dryers.

      With a stay at Extended Stay America Suites Greensboro Wendover Ave in Greensboro, you'll be within a 15-minute drive of Greensboro Coliseum and Wet 'n Wild Emerald Pointe Water Park. This hotel is 8.4 mi (13.6 km) from North Carolina A and T State University and 9.9 mi (15.9 km) from High Point University.Make use of convenient am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access, a television in a common area, and a picnic area. This hotel also features barbecue grills and a vending machine.A complimentary on-the-go breakfast is served daily from 6 AM to 9:30 AM.Featured amenities include a 24-hour front desk, laundry facilities, and a safe deposit box at the front desk. Free self parking is available onsite.Make yourself at home in one of the 72 air-conditioned rooms featuring kitchens with refrigerators and stovetops. 32-inch flat-screen televisions with cable programming provide entertainment, while compl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ected. Conveniences include phones, as well as microwaves and irons/ironing boards.

      With a stay at La Quinta Inn & Suites by Wyndham Greensboro NC in Greensboro, you'll be near the airport, within a 10-minute drive of Greensboro Coliseum and Celebration Station. This hotel is 7.3 mi (11.7 km) from Wet 'n Wild Emerald Pointe Water Park and 8.1 mi (13 km) from North Carolina A and T State University.Enjoy the recreation opportunities such as a fitness center or make use of other amenities including complimentary wireless internet access.A complimentary self-serve breakfast is served on weekdays from 6:00 AM to 9:00 AM and on weekends from 7:00 AM to 10:00 AM.Featured amenities include a business center, a 24-hour front desk, and multilingual staff. Planning an event in Greensboro? This hotel has 484 square feet (45 square meters) of space consisting of conference space and a meeting room. Free self parking is available onsite.Make yourself at home in one of the 131 guestrooms featuring refrigerators and microwaves. 35-inch flat-screen televisions with cable programming provide entertainment, while compl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ected. Bathrooms feature bathtubs or showers, complimentary toiletries, and hair dryers. Conveniences include desks and coffee/tea makers, as well as phones with free local calls.
